October 3, 2011, Toronto – The Canadian Pastry Chefs Guild held their fall meeting at Pâtisserie La Cigogne in Toronto.

Thierry Schmitt, owner and artist behind Pâtisserie La Cigogne, demonstrated building croquembouches for the Guild in his very new second location on Danforth Ave. in Toronto’s east end. He opened his first location in 2003. Schmitt is a French master pastry chef with over 30 years of experience.

The Sept. 21 meeting also held a moment of silence in honour of Hermann Ackerman, who died on June 25. Hermann was a founding member of the Guild, active organizer of social events and a dedicated member for many years.
